Output 6230e0bbc34e17a29d95b017202faf54ebb8f9e7530e82f943ce056ba6c71123:4

value
23699563
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c2da2121f4eef404b6d537d43c54fccdc5eab378 OP_EQUAL
address
MRfSdYUEsySyqLb186MXec13R8Y5ienJen
transaction
6230e0bbc34e17a29d95b017202faf54ebb8f9e7530e82f943ce056ba6c71123
spent
true